Yonex Dutch Open: Kristina Gavnholt overpowers Judith Meulendijks to take Women’s Singles title
Czech Republic’s impressive shuttler Kristina Gavnholt showed her craft in the arena and won the Women’s Singles title after crushing Netherland’s Judith Meulendijks in the final encounter at Yonex Dutch Open 2012 on Sunday, October 14, in Netherlands.
The impressive Kristina, who was seeded at number three in Women’s Singles draw in Dutch Open, had to work really hard in the title match to overpower her local rival and remained successful in winning the contest in three games with a close margin.
The un-seeded Judith, on the contrary, showed a great resistance to her higher ranked rival by playing at her best speed. She did not give up until the ending points of the game and despite losing the match in three games, made her fans happy by the way she fought in the arena.
In the first set, the Kristina was in all sorts of trouble as she failed to stop the aggression and attacking play of her local opponent and remained struggling on court.
On the other hand, Judith did not spare any chance for her rival to put up even meagre resistance as she executed powerful strokes in all areas and took an impressive lead until the break.
After the one-minute interval, Kristina tried to change her tactics but failed to put up good show and eventually lost the opening set with a 14-21 score on the board.
Stung by the loss of opening set, Kristina played attacking game in the starting points of second game and she managed to get a strong position by setting up a wonderful lead until the break.
After the interval, Kristina continued her elevated play without showing any mercy to her lower ranked opponent and won the set with a 21-13 margin on score board.
In the deciding game, both players showed aggression in opening half and stayed close until the one-minute break.
After the interval, Kristina showed aggression and managed to take a reasonable lead by gearing up her speed in all areas and won the set with a four-point advantage of 21-17.
Kristina bagged Women’s Singles title by winning the final contest in three games with a 14-21, 21-13 and 21-17 score on the board.
